What’s a Registered Agent?




A registered agent is a individual or business entity appointed to accept legal documents as well as critical correspondence on behalf of the corporation or limited liability company (LLC). This agent serves as the official point of contact between the business with state authorities, making sure that critical communications, such as service of process as well as compliance notifications, get properly handled.




Registered agents serve a crucial role in upholding a business's legal status. They help companies stay compliant with state regulations by making certain that necessary documents, such as annual reports as well as renewal notices, get submitted punctually. Criteria and Duties of Registered Agents




To operate effectively, registered agents must fulfill specific criteria mandated by state law. Typically, these consist of being a citizen of the region where the business is established or having a business address within that jurisdiction. Firms often choose a registered agent company that focuses in offering these solutions, ensuring adherence with regional regulations. Additionally, the registered agent must be accessible during regular business hours to accept important official documents on behalf of the business.




The primary responsibilities of a registered agent involve receiving and handling legal documents, like service of process, tax notices, and other official correspondence. This role is crucial for making certain that companies do not miss critical timelines or legal obligations. Agents also support in the compliance management process by sending notifications for annual submissions and changes in business status, ensuring that their clients stay in good condition with state authorities.

Cost of Registered Agent Solutions




In the context of registered agent services, pricing is a major factor for numerous businesses. The cost for engaging a registered agent can vary widely based on the company and the services offered. Typically, you can expect to pay anywhere from $50 to $300 per year for fundamental registered agent services. Cost-effective registered agent choices are available, but it's crucial to make sure that you're not compromising on reliability and compliance assistance, as this is essential for maintaining good standing with state requirements.




Besides the standard fees, businesses should be aware of any potential additional fees associated with registered agent services. For instance, some registered agent providers offer extra services like compliance reminders, handling of mail, and annual report filing, which may come with added fees. Evaluating these services and their costs can help you identify the most suitable registered agent provider that fulfills your needs without hidden charges.
